The Rcs rush to Piazza Affari continues. The title of the publishing group, after having recorded a rise of 26% yesterday, continues the rally and is suspended in volatility auction with a theoretical gain of more than 13%, at €1,957 per share. The exchanges are very intense.
The Rcs quotations are driven by speculation on the reorganization, above all in the light the clear strengthening of Fiat within the shareholding structure: after the capital increase, Lingotto will be the first shareholder of the group, with over 20% of the capital.
In addition to the position of Diego Della Valle, still to be clarified, some doubts remain about the possible division of the company, while Consob could evaluate the obligation of a takeover bid by Fiat and the other shareholders adhering to the agreement.
